In this role, you will provide hands-on and remote technical support to end users while also managing IT assets throughout their lifecycle. You'll oversee hardware and software inventory, ensure compliance with licensing, support deployments, and maintain accurate documentation. Your work will help ensure reliable, secure, and efficient technology operations across the organization.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ide responsive, hands-on and remote technical support to end users, resolving complex hardware and software issues
  • Manage and track IT assets, ensuring accurate inventory, lifecycle oversight, and readiness for deployment
  • Coordinate hardware and software procurement, setup, and distribution to support operational needs
  • Maintain system updates, including firmware patches and configurations, to ensure optimal performance and security
  • Monitor and document software licensing to ensure compliance and support audit readiness
  • Develop and maintain clear documentation of IT procedures, processes, and asset records
  • Support compliance efforts by assisting with audits, reporting, and regulatory requirements
  • Oversee secure handling and disposal of electronic media to protect sensitive data
  • Collaborate with IT team members and stakeholders to improve processes and technology solutions
